What Is a Web3 Wallet?
A Web3 wallet is a digital tool that enables users to store, manage, and interact with blockchain-based assets such as cryptocurrencies, stablecoins, and non-fungible tokens (NFTs). Unlike traditional Web2 wallets—often tied to centralized services—Web3 wallets are non-custodial, meaning users retain full control over their private keys and funds.
These wallets serve as gateways to the decentralized web, allowing seamless access to dApps (decentralized applications), DeFi protocols, NFT marketplaces, and even virtual worlds within the metaverse. Transactions are secured through cryptographic signatures, typically initiated by entering a seed phrase or using biometric authentication.

Leading Web3 Wallets in 2025
Several wallets have emerged as industry leaders due to their functionality, security, and ease of use.
MetaMask
One of the most popular Web3 wallets, MetaMask operates on Ethereum and supports EVM-compatible chains. Available as a browser extension and mobile app, it enables smooth interaction with dApps and decentralized exchanges.
Rainbow
A sleek, non-custodial wallet built for Ethereum users. Rainbow supports ENS (Ethereum Name Service) domains and offers intuitive design elements. Developers can also leverage RainbowKit to integrate wallet functionality into their platforms.
Argent
Designed for DeFi enthusiasts, Argent runs on zkSync and supports Ethereum Layer-1 and StarkNet. It features smart contract-based security, including social recovery and gas-free transactions.
Coinbase Wallet
While associated with the Coinbase exchange, this wallet is non-custodial and independent. It supports multiple blockchains and introduces user-friendly features like human-readable usernames instead of complex addresses.
Trust Wallet
Known for its broad chain support and built-in dApp browser, Trust Wallet also offers staking options—enabling users to earn passive income directly from their holdings.

Frequently Asked Questions (FAQ)
Q: Is a Web3 wallet safe?
A: Yes, when developed with strong security practices. Since users control their private keys, there's no central point of failure. However, phishing attacks and poor key management remain risks—so education and secure design are crucial.
Q: Can a Web3 wallet support multiple blockchains?
A: Absolutely. Multi-chain wallets are increasingly common, allowing users to manage assets across Ethereum, Solana, Polygon, and others from one interface.
Q: Do I need coding skills to use a Web3 wallet?
A: No. While developers use them for dApp interactions, end-users only need basic navigation skills. Features like seed phrases and biometric login make them accessible to non-technical users.
Q: What’s the difference between custodial and non-custodial wallets?
A: Custodial wallets (like exchange accounts) hold your keys for you. Non-custodial wallets—typical in Web3—give you full control, enhancing security but requiring personal responsibility.
Q: How long does it take to build a Web3 wallet?
A: Typically 3–6 months, depending on complexity. Simple single-chain wallets take less time; advanced multi-chain or DeFi-integrated versions may require longer development cycles.
Q: Can I add staking or NFT support to my wallet?
A: Yes. Modern Web3 wallets often include staking dashboards, NFT galleries, and dApp browsers to enhance utility and user engagement.
